any time you add a larger turbo (especially a fixed geometry) without swapping to a higher stall converter, your stall speed will drop. When this happens, drivabilit­y suffers. Retarding your injection timing can help bring the charger to life quicker (or adjusting vane positionin­g if you went with a larger VGT), but there is only so much your tuner can do to make an improperly-spec’d converter work with a larger turbo.
